Abstract

The Extended Kalman Filter (EKF) has become one of the options to achieved synchronization of chaotic signals with important applications for wireless communications. However the joint operation of the EKF and the chaotic signals suffers from several reported drawbacks that negatively affect the performance of the EKF up to a breaking point. This paper shows a rather simple way of establishing a reference threshold that allows to avoid the breaking point and keeps the EKF in a working regime that yields good performance in terms of the Mean Square Error (MSE) between the real and estimated chaotic signals. Three different chaotic systems are used to illustrate the proposed approach.
